Step 2: Understand Your Visa Options
Your visa determines how long you can stay, whether you can work, and your path toward long-term residency.
Before making any relocation plans, it’s important to understand which visa category applies to your situation.
Popular Visa Types:
- Digital Nomad Visas
- Retirement & Passive Income Visas
- Self-Employment Visas
- Investor Visas
- Student Visas

Step 3: Calculate Your Cost of Living
One of the biggest mistakes future expats make is underestimating the true cost of relocation.
Beyond rent, you’ll need to consider:
- Healthcare
- Transportation
- Groceries
- Utilities
- Visa fees
- Flights
- Temporary housing
- Emergency savings

Step 6: Understand Taxes & Banking
Moving abroad doesn’t eliminate your financial responsibilities.
Americans living overseas often need to navigate:
- U.S. tax filing requirements
- Foreign bank accounts
- Residency rules
- International money transfers
- Local banking systems
